Skip to content

Commit fc40994

Browse files
committed
Merge branch 'main' into echavemann/led-matrix-redo
2 parents 4a9f5c7 + 26acd41 commit fc40994

File tree

4 files changed

+3
-108
lines changed

4 files changed

+3
-108
lines changed

include/drivers/timer.hpp

Lines changed: 0 additions & 77 deletions
This file was deleted.

include/drivers/virtual_timer_controller.hpp

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-41,6 +41,8 @@ class VirtualTimerController {
4141
);
4242
void virtual_timer_cancel(uint32_t timer_id);
4343

44+
uint32_t read_timer() const;
45+
4446
static VirtualTimerController& get();
4547

4648
VirtualTimerController(VirtualTimerController&) = delete;
@@ -57,8 +59,6 @@ class VirtualTimerController {
5759

5860
void enqueue_next_timer() const;
5961

60-
uint32_t read_timer() const;
61-
6262
uint32_t timer_start(
6363
uint32_t microseconds, ProcessCallbackPtr callback, ProcessId timer_creator
6464
);

src/drivers/driver_commands.cpp

Lines changed: 1 addition &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-3,7 +3,6 @@
33
#include "drivers/button_driver.hpp"
44
#include "drivers/driver_enums.hpp"
55
#include "drivers/led_matrix_controller.hpp"
6-
#include "drivers/timer.hpp"
76
#include "drivers/virtual_timer_controller.hpp"
87
#include "util.hpp"
98

@@ -18,7 +17,7 @@ etl::optional<int> handle_command(DriverCommand type, int arg1, int arg2, int ar
1817
LedMatrixController::get().set_led(arg1, arg2, arg3);
1918
break;
2019
case DriverCommand::GET_TIME:
21-
return timer4_controller.get_time_us();
20+
return VirtualTimerController::get().read_timer();
2221
case DriverCommand::TERMINAL_OUTPUT:
2322
printf((char*)arg1);
2423
break;

src/drivers/timer.cpp

Lines changed: 0 additions & 27 deletions
This file was deleted.

0 commit comments

Comments
 (0)